What is the minimum time for a Soldier to receive feedback after filing a complaint?

Explanation:
The correct choice reflects that a Soldier must receive feedback after filing a complaint within 14 calendar days. This timeframe is established to ensure that complaints are addressed promptly, allowing for timely resolution of issues. It underscores the importance of maintaining clear channels of communication and support for Soldiers, fostering a responsive environment for addressing concerns related to their service or treatment. By setting a standard of 14 days, the system encourages accountability and reinforces the commitment to uphold Soldiers' rights, facilitating an environment where concerns can be raised and addressed effectively.
